An IT Administrator is responsible for overseeing and maintaining the company’s technology infrastructure, ensuring that all systems, networks, and software are functioning efficiently. This role involves troubleshooting issues, providing technical support, managing hardware and software installations, and ensuring the security of all IT systems.
Key Responsibilities:
- Manage and maintain the company’s IT infrastructure, including servers, networks, and hardware.
- Install, configure, and update software and hardware systems.
- Provide technical support to employees, troubleshooting and resolving IT issues.
- Monitor system performance, ensuring optimal operation and minimizing downtime.
- Ensure the security of all IT systems by implementing and updating security protocols, firewalls, and antivirus software.
- Backup critical data.
- Manage user accounts, permissions, and access control to ensure data security and confidentiality.
- Prepare and maintain documentation for IT procedures, network configurations, and system setups.
- Stay up to date with the latest IT trends and technologies to improve the company’s infrastructure.
